Into the Frozen Winter
“Into the frozen winter, darkness, stillness, ebb. Dec. 18 – my last chemo. Dec. 21 – the darkest day. Then bit by bit the light returns.”
A new journal portrait to follow this one and this one. The author wrote this towards the end of her cancer treatment. She reflected on how her illness seemed to correspond to the changing seasons. For a larger version, click on the image.
